This is something completely new to me - that the RAF Regiment (the infantry section of the Royal Air Force) has specialist snipers whose role is to acquire targets from helicopters!

These lads operate in Iraq from Merlin and Lynx helicopters. I personally cannot imagine how skilled you must be to be able to take a shot from a moving helicopter, and I imagine this must be completely demoralizing for the enemy.
